Tangy Banana Bars
Ingredients List
- -JUDI M. PHELPS
- 1 c Brown sugar; firmly packed
- 1/2 c Margarine or butter
- 1 Jar apricot preserves-10 oz
- 1 ts Vanilla
- 2 Eggs
- 1 3/4 c All purpose flour
- 1/2 ts Baking powder
- 1/2 ts Baking soda
- 1 c Bananas; thinly sliced about
- -2 medium
- 3/4 c Nuts; chopped (your choice)
- Powdered sugar
Directions
Heat oven to 350 degrees. Grease 13 x 9-inch pan. In large bowl, combine
brown sugar, margarine, preserves, vanilla, and eggs; blend well. Lightly
spoon flour into measuring cup; level off. By hand, stir in remaining
ingredients except powdered sugar; mix just until blended. Pour into
prepared pan.
Bake at 350 degrees for 30-40 minutes or until toothpick inserted in center
comes out clean. Cool completely; sprinkle with powdered sugar. Cut into
bars. Makes 36 bars. 2 bars = 228 calories, 8 g fat.
